ADMINISTRATIVE & CLERICAL

<<-- Back

 

 

The Administrative & Clerical tests are multiple choice, matching and true/false type questions ranging from 15 to 30 questions per test.  Most tests cover beginner, intermediate and advanced levels all within each test.   The test allows test taker to skip questions and review the work at the end of the test.  Every test is being timed and the time taken on the test is provided on the score report. 

The CD version offers a PLUS package that allows you to customize most tests - giving the ability to pick and choose questions for each test.  Test that include an * are customizable.  The PLUS package also includes the Test-Maker Tool, which allows custom tests to be made.  Custom tests can include multiple choice, fill in the blank, matching and true/false.
